#e3b3ea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e3b3ea is composed of 89% red, 70.2%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 292.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 81%. #e3b3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c767d5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#e3b3ea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e3b3ea has RGB values of R:227, G:179,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 14922730.

Shades and Tints of #e3b3ea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#faf0f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3b3ea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d0cdd0 is the less saturated color, while #f1a0fd is the most saturated one.
